    For those of you that don't know - I've been training for several months with my team to conquer the Oxfam Trailwalker that is happening this Friday in Hong Kong.

    The Trailwalker is an annual charity event devoted to raising funds for development and poverty relief for people in underdeveloped
    nations.

    The course consists of a 100km hike over the MacLehose trail from east Hong Kong to west, and has a vertical gain of 14,000ft.

    The structure is unique: four-person teams run the entire race together, similar to an adventure race. All four members must stay together the entire way, checking into ten different checkpoints along the course. A team is disqualified (although allowed to continue non-competitively) if any member of the team drops out.

    You are allowed 48 hours to finish it.

    We aim to hike/run it in 20.

    To put that in perspective, the Gurkha's run the whole damn thing in 13.
